Как добавить ссылки на соцсети в моем андроид-приложении?
Я новичок, хочу в свое приложение добавить кнопки на соцсети. Приложение - это информационный ресурс описывающий одну организацию и соответственно, необходимо вставить кнопки отпр…
Я новичок, хочу в свое приложение добавить кнопки на соцсети. Приложение - это информационный ресурс описывающий одну организацию и соответственно, необходимо вставить кнопки отпр…
Пишу курсовой и не совсем понимаю, как правильно вывести видеоролики, добавленные в избранное. В базу они заносятся и вроде как нормально. Вывод обычных видео на главную страницу …
Подскажите, как получить положение окна? Пробовал так: val posX = remember { mutableStateOf(WindowState().position) } Text( " ${posX.value.y} ${posX.value.x}", fontSize …
Есть диалог BottomSheetDialogFragment и тема Theme.Material3.Light.NoActionBar. Нужно сделать задний фон диалога таким же как у активити. Гайд предлагает изменить backgroundTint у…
Делаю приложение на Kotlin под Android и столкнулась с проблемой. Суть приложения - сканировать текст и находить вредные "Е"шки в отсканированном тексте. Когда я сканиру…
open class Tag(val name: String, val value: String) { var children: MutableList<Tag> = mutableListOf() fun add(tag: Tag) = children.add(tag) override fun toString(): String …
Я пишу тест для API метода, который может принимать несколько типов данных, но, понятное дело, не все. Мне бы хотелось найти возможность передавать в функцию один из возможных тип…
Данные в массив заносятся, а список не обновляется Adapter class AdapterImages: ListAdapter<ImageModel, AdapterImages.ViewHolder>(DiffCallback()) { class ViewHolder( val ite…
Я пытаюсь сделать приложение для создания PDF. Используя 3 библиотеки на flutter: pdf 3.10.3, path_provider 2.0.15, open_document 1.0.6+2. Код будет чуть ниже. Суть в том, что на …
Не находит элементы по id, получаю ошибку: Unresolved reference Код адаптера: package com.OxGomer.exchangerates.screens.start import android.annotation.SuppressLint import android…
Зарегался в google cloud: class MainActivity : AppCompatActivity() { override fun onCreate(savedInstanceState: Bundle?) { super.onCreate(savedInstanceState) setContentView(R.layou…
У меня есть в коде dropDownMenu и при выборе опции почему то вылетает, код: Box(){ Text(text = selectedOption, color = Colors().TextWhite, fontSize = 14.sp) DropdownMenu(expanded …
Написал программу на Kotlin для Android, необходимо сделать отчетность по проделанной работе. Как правильно оформлять программу/исходный код программы в документации?
У меня есть код браузера. В нем все работает, кроме отображения адреса страницы. Подскажите, как исправить это? Вот мой MainActivity: class MainActivity : AppCompatActivity() { ov…
Подскажите, пожалуйста, есть ли какой-то способ сохранения видео в офлайн для просмотра без интернета, но при этом чтобы оно не отображалось в галерее у пользователя? Похожим обра…
Нашел аналог ViewPager2 в Jetpack Сompose — HorizontalPager. Не могу понять, как реализовать его с тремя разными экранами. Каждый экран имеет разную верстку.
У меня есть Pager основанный на фрагментах, т.к. всего 3 страницы. И при скроле у меня разная высота контента и Pager ее обрезает. Решил обойти это сделав метод который активирует…
Делаю одно тестовое задание, в котором нужно реализовать файловый менеджер с индексацией содержимого файлов и при каждом запуске проверять, что изменилось. Есть база данных, в кот…
Есть LiveData на котороую подписывается View вот так В аналитике вижу отчет об краше в котором говориться Location: MyFile.kt line 116 in MyFragment$setupObservers$2.invoke Except…
У меня в бд имеются две сущности: Дни (айди(первичный ключ), день) и Упражнения (айди(внешний ключ), упражнение, айди_дня (внешний ключ)). В ресайклвью я закидываю карточки, котор…
Господа, делаю приложение, в котором нужная часть выглядит следующим образом: пользователь жмякает на кнопочку и вводит дату --> появляется карточка с названием даты в ресайклв…
У меня есть примерно такая планировка экранов - BottomNavigationView + home + list + profile + details + create мне нужно сделать переход с home -> create, list->details еди…
Есть маска текста: xxx/13xx/xxx Есть текст: 222/1300/777 Как я могу получить текст 22200777 ? .replace("/13", "") отработает криво на примере 222/1300/135
При попытке скачать файл, получаю ошибку: Suspend functions cannot be made Composable Как можно поправить? @Composable suspend fun CheckVerMain(): File? { val context = LocalConte…
пробовала менять версии тоже не получается выходит 2 ошибки 1) Caused by: org.gradle.api.internal.plugins.PluginApplicationException: Failed to apply plugin 'com.android.internal.…
Я хочу реализовать простой выбор файла с получением его uri Но когда я искал один в Интернете, они показали метод с startActivityforResult, где они получили uri, но теперь это уст…
Вот попробовал по совету чат гпт так: var content2 = "<html>\n" + " <head>\n" + " <title>Моя страница</title>\n" + " <…
у меня есть такая хмелька: <?xml version="1.0" encoding="utf-8"?> <shape xmlns:android="http://schemas.android.com/apk/res/android" > <…
В общем, такая ситуация. Есть n-ное количество микросервисов и отдельный сервис, который представляет собой совокупность собственных библиотек. Соответственно, меняя что-то в како…
Начал разрабатывать приложение с BottomNavigationView, сделал 3 фрагмента, выбрал начальный элемент меню. Но когда возвращаешься на данный фрагмент информация там дублируется. Про…